我正在尝试学习圆形工厂但我在设置
时遇到错误final ImageView fabIconNew = new ImageView(this);
fabIconNew.setImageDrawable(getResources().getDrawable(R.drawable.ic_action_new));
final FloatingActionButton rightLowerButton = new FloatingActionButton.Builder(this)
.setContentView(fabIconNew)
.build();
SubActionButton.Builder rLSubBuilder = new SubActionButton.Builder(this);
ImageView rlIcon1 = new ImageView(this);
ImageView rlIcon2 = new ImageView(this);
ImageView rlIcon3 = new ImageView(this);
ImageView rlIcon4 = new ImageView(this);
rlIcon1.setImageDrawable(getResources().getDrawable(R.drawable.ic_action_contact));
rlIcon2.setImageDrawable(getResources().getDrawable(R.drawable.ic_action_currency_info));
rlIcon3.setImageDrawable(getResources().getDrawable(R.drawable.ic_action_exhibition));
rlIcon4.setImageDrawable(getResources().getDrawable(R.drawable.ic_action_faq));
我在Builder上遇到错误(这个) 它显示无法解析符号生成器 我想从这里制作圆形按钮https://github.com/oguzbilgener/CircularFloatingActionMenu 我添加了编译时依赖项 有人可以告诉我如何解决这个错误
答案 0 :(得分:1)
您尝试使用的FloatingActionButton
来自com.android.support:design
,它没有Builder()
方法。
您需要使用FloatingActionButton
中的com.oguzdev:CircularFloatingActionMenu
。
删除import android.support.design.widget.FloatingActionButton;
并添加
import com.oguzdev.circularfloatingactionmenu.library.FloatingActionButton;
您想要使用com.oguzdev:CircularFloatingActionMenu
' s FloatingActionButton
。